Understanding the Mechanics of Monster-Themed Slots

At the heart of any successful slot game, including those featuring monstrous themes, lies a robust and engaging game mechanic. These aren't simply about random chance; a sophisticated system of algorithms and probability dictates the outcome of each spin, ensuring a balance between fairness and excitement. Random Number Generators (RNGs) are crucial – they are independently audited to verify their impartiality and prevent manipulation. Understanding this foundation is the first step to appreciating the intricacies of playing these games. The return to player (RTP) percentage is an important aspect, indicating the average amount of wagered money that’s returned to players over time. A higher RTP generally signifies a more favorable game for the player, but it’s vital to remember that this is a long-term average and doesn’t guarantee individual wins.

The paylines themselves are a fundamental aspect of the gameplay. Traditionally, slots featured a limited number of fixed paylines, but modern games often offer adjustable paylines, allowing players to choose how many lines to activate. More active paylines increase the chances of landing a winning combination but also increase the cost per spin. The symbols are, of course, crucial. Monster-themed slots will naturally showcase a variety of monstrous figures, often with different values assigned to them. Higher-value symbols typically require rarer combinations to land, reflecting their greater potential payout.

Bonus Features and Volatility

The real thrill often comes from the bonus features triggered by specific symbol combinations. These can range from simple free spin rounds to complex interactive mini-games. Cascading reels, where winning symbols disappear and new ones fall into place, creating the potential for multiple wins from a single spin, are incredibly popular. Sticky wilds, which remain in place for subsequent spins, further enhance the winning potential. Bonus features are intricately tied to the monster theme, reinforcing the immersive experience. For example, a 'Monster Mash' bonus could have monsters randomly transforming symbols into wilds. Another popular feature is the ‘Pick and Click’ bonus, where players select from a set of hidden symbols to reveal instant prizes.

Volatility, also known as variance, is another important consideration. High volatility slots offer larger but less frequent wins, while low volatility slots provide smaller, more consistent payouts. Players should choose games that align with their risk tolerance and playing style. Understanding Paylines and Bet Sizes

Paylines are the lines on which winning symbol combinations are evaluated. Some slots offer a fixed number of paylines, while others allow players to select the number of lines they want to activate. Activating more paylines increases the chances of winning but also increases the cost per spin. Bet size is another important factor. Players can typically adjust their bet size by selecting the number of coins per line and their coin value. A larger bet size increases the potential payout but also increases the risk. It’s crucial to find a balance between bet size and bankroll management.

Understanding how the paylines interact with the symbols is also vital. Some games require symbols to land in a specific order on adjacent reels, while others allow for scatter wins, where symbols don’t need to be on a payline to trigger a payout.
